Fishery overview
The Osage River at Tuscumbia is the bounded Miller County tailwater and lower-Osage warmwater fishery below Bagnell Dam. StrikeTracks publishes Monitoring-Backed conditions from USGS 06926080 using live water temperature, discharge, and stage. This is not Lake of the Ozarks, not Harry S. Truman Reservoir, and not a generic Missouri River pin. Flow Context remains default-deny.

Fishery characteristics
- Composition
- Mixed wild and stocked
- Great Lakes tributary
- No
- Flow regime
- Tailwater
Regulated Osage River mainstem at Tuscumbia, downstream of Bagnell Dam and upstream of the Missouri River confluence. Distinct from Lake of the Ozarks pool, from Truman Dam tailwater into the lake, and from Gasconade River.
